India will start their Super 8 campaign in the T20 World Cup 2026 against South Africa in Ahmedabad, with coach Morne Morkel confident batters will improve against spin. Despite struggles, India have posted big totals and plan to accelerate after building a base. India also face Zimbabwe and West Indies next. The match starts at 7 PM IST and will be live on Star Sports and Jio Hotstar.
